The device namely, ZTE Q519T, is an Android based smartphone featuring Android Lollipop out of the box.

ZTE Q519T launch

ZTE Q519T features a quad core MediaTek MT6735 processor with a clocking speed of 1 GHz, to be assisted by 1 GB of RAM and 8 GB of in built storage which can be expanded further up to 32 GB by using a microSD card. A Mali T720 MP1 GPU rests onboard to look after the graphic output of the smartphone. It comes with a 5 inch HD display which flaunts a screen resolution of 1280×720 pixels. The smartphone sports a 5 MP rear facing camera with LED flash and a 2 MP front facing secondary camera too. ZTE Q519T runs on Android Lollipop platform and offers dual sim connectivity with 4G LTE support.

ZTE Q519T Specifications

  • 1 GHz quad core MediaTek MT6735 SoC
  • 1 GB RAM, Mali T720 MP1 GPU
  • 8 GB in built storage (microSD card support up to 32 GB)
  • 5 inch HD display (1280×720 pixels)
  • Android Lollipop 5.0 OS
  • 5 MP rear facing primary camera with LED flash
  • 2 MP fixed focus front facing camera
  • Wi-Fi, Bluetooth, GPS, 4G LTE, 3G, dual sim
  • 4000 mAh battery

ZTE Q519T price in China has been disclosed as CNY 599. ZTE Q519T release date has not yet been officially declared.
